Hiring an asynchronous (Async) developer can bring numerous benefits to a project or organization. Firstly, Async developers can create applications that maximize efficiency and responsiveness. They use non-blocking code to ensure that applications can continue running other tasks while waiting for other operations to complete, thus improving the overall performance.
Secondly, Async developers can help in building scalable applications. With their ability to handle multiple requests concurrently, they can write code that effectively manages resources, even under high traffic scenarios. This is particularly beneficial for web-based applications and services.
Thirdly, they can significantly enhance the user experience. By implementing asynchronous programming, the user interface remains responsive and fluid, even during complex computations or data retrieval. This leads to a better user experience, making users more likely to stay, engage, and convert.
Finally, Async developers can also help to reduce the costs associated with server and infrastructure. Asynchronous code can handle more requests with fewer resources, which can result in a significant reduction in server costs.
Overall, hiring an Async developer can be a major asset in creating highly efficient, scalable, and user-friendly applications, while potentially reducing operational costs.